The picture book:
During the Second World War, Joni-Pip’s American Father moves her and her family to Sherwood Forest in Nottinghamshire, England. When her life in the wood begins she is amazed to discover that Ethelred-Ted, her favourite toy and all the animals in the wood can speak!
The novel:
This is practically a text-only version of The Life in the Wood with Joni-Pip. It is a Children’s Adventure that appeals to all ages. The story is set in 1942 in England and spans three centuries, where the characters Jump in Time to try and make a Bad Past into a Better Future. It is Book One of The Circles Trilogy and has been described by Best Selling Author, R.J. Ellory as ‘A Rare Feast for Children…a Fabulous Journey’.
What is Deja vu? What is the Wall of Time? What is the Secret of the Stars? What are Personal Orbits of Life? Is it possible to Jump in Time to change a Bad Past without serious consequences for the Future? Do these affect us all?
12-year-old Joni-Pip discovers the spectacular answers to these questions after being taken to live in Sherwood Forest by her American Father following the Bombing of Bath in 1942.
In this compelling adventure, BOOK ONE of The CIRCLES Trilogy, we are introduced to characters from three different centuries as they join together in a wonderful world of knowledge, discovery, suspense, fun, sadness and elation in their Quest to unravel the Mysteries of Jumping in Time, The Kaleidoscope of Life, The Keep of Good Memories and the Secret of the Stars.
